I will not be disingenuous and read the script in closing because the Deputy is well aware of the response.

The issue he is raising is a much broader issue in terms of the reality of living on the islands in this day and age. It is a broader issue for Government and future governments to consider in respect of the economic, financial and other supports that can be put in place to ensure - it is something we all want to achieve - that we keep families living on the islands but also increase the number of people living on the islands, and particularly attract young people who want to choose living out on our beautiful islands as a lifestyle and a wonderful way of living.

As I outlined in the opening response, that is the scheme that is in place, but what the Deputy is raising here is a much broader issue about affordability and the harsh reality at times of services being available on the mainland and people being able to access those services and being able to afford to access those services. I will take this back to the Minister and for wider discussion within government around that as well.
